The children of Teheran / a film by Dalia Guttman, David Tour, Yehuda Kaveh.

Publication | Library Call Number: DVD-1359

"Some 700 orphans who immigrated to Israel in February 1943 are the subject of "Tehran Children," a documentary film which interviews now middle-aged 'Tehran Children, ' to find out how they are coping with their memories or lack of memories of their arrival in Israel, which at the time caused a tumult in the pre-state Jewish community. The story of the "Tehran Children" began during World War II, when Jewish refugees from Poland crossed the border into Russia to escape the Nazis"--Avi Chai (Israel).
